查看更多
选择

如何利用CSS实现网页动画效果 - 网站技术小窍门

Publication cover
分类:  技术
时间:  2025-07-27 00:00:08
作者:  5acxy

在当今互联网高速发展的时代,网站设计越来越注重用户体验,吸引用户眼球的动画效果成为设计师们追逐的目标。而在网站技术中,利用CSS实现网页动画效果成为其中一大热门话题。


首先,CSS动画是一种在不使用JavaScript的情况下实现动画效果的方法,它可以有效减少网页的加载时间,提升用户体验。围绕这一技术点,我们可以通过几个方面进行拓展:


一、关键帧动画:利用CSS的@keyframes规则,我们可以定义多个关键帧,并指定每个关键帧的样式,从而实现复杂的动画效果,比如旋转、缩放、渐变等。


二、过渡动画:通过CSS的transition属性,我们可以控制元素在不同状态之间的过渡效果,使页面的交互更加流畅。常见的过渡效果包括渐变、放大缩小、颜色变化等。


三、动画延迟和速度控制:CSS允许我们通过animation-delay和animation-duration等属性,精确控制动画的延迟时间和持续时间,从而使动画效果更符合设计要求。


总结来说,利用CSS实现网页动画效果不仅可以提升用户体验,还可以减少对JavaScript的依赖,简化代码结构。设计师们可以通过不断学习和实践,掌握更多的CSS动画技巧,为网站增添更多惊喜。